Learn How to Spot a Mate in 2: Kingside Attack
This middlegame puzzle is a classic example of a forcing kingside attack where king safety matters more than material. White’s pieces are already aimed at the enemy king, and the position contains a clear tactical pattern: a clearance sacrifice that opens lines for a decisive mating net. In practical classical chess, these motifs often appear when the defender’s back rank or king shelter is overloaded and one forcing move removes the key blocker.
